ANALYSIS OF THE SPRING CONSTANT IN SPRING WITH NON-UNIFORM SPRING DIAMETER
description The Spring is a widely used object for a variety of equipment systems. Physics phenomena that occur in spring can be explained by Hooke’s law. Each spring have a spring constant value that indicating the stiffness of the spring. The shape of a spring based on the diameter of a spring may vary, such as a cylindrical spring with a uniform spring diameter and a conical spring, barrel spring, and a hourglass spring with a non-uniform spring diameter. The purpose of this research is to analyze the value of spring constant from spring with a non-uniform spring diameter experimentally with static and dynamic method, and to determine the equation of the spring constant for a spring with a non-uniform spring diameter. 14 pieces of springs are used and each spring have different characteristics with wire diameter 0.8 mm and made from stainless steel. 8 pieces of additional springs are used with the shape of springs arranged in series to support the result obtained from spring with a non-uniform spring diameter. In research, mean value of total spring diameter from each spring are calculated and used to calculated the value of spring constant theoretically, and compared with the result from experiment. From this comparison, the value of spring constant theoretically using mean value of total spring diameter not much different from the value of spring constant from experiment. So that the equation of the spring constant for a spring with a non-uniform spring diameter is obtained by using mean value of total spring diameter in the existing calculation formula.
